Super affordable lens mount flash kit for DSLR’s

Share
Photo company Brando has come up with a super inexpensive, lens mounted, flash ring for DSLR cameras.  It runs on AA batteries and is pretty much only useful for macro photography.  What do you want for $58?
You can use it in half ring mode or full, and it fits a variety of mount sizes.  Check [...]
